Blank sailing
A scheduled sailing that has been cancelled by a carrier or shipping line so a vessel skips certain ports or even the entire route
Blind Shipment
A shipping arrangement in which the identity of the sender is concealed from the recipient.
Blockchain
A decentralized, distributed ledger of information shared digitally through a peer-to-peer network
Blue economy
The sustainable use of ocean resources for economic growth, job creation and improvement of the ocean ecosystem
Bonded warehouse
A secure facility where goods are stored until customs duties are paid
Book and claim
A process where airlines and logistics providers claim the environmental benefits associated with s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) even if they do not use SAF.
